**Tragedy Exposes Flaws in Sanctuary Policies: Veteran Murdered by Illegal Immigrant**

In a heartbreaking incident that has sent shockwaves through the community, 83-year-old Air Force veteran Richard Williams died from injuries sustained after being shoved onto New York City subway tracks by an illegal immigrant.

The accused, 34-year-old Honduran national Bairon Hernandez, has been charged with second-degree murder following the death of the beloved veteran. This tragic event highlights a broader issue surrounding immigration policies and their impact on public safety.


On March 8, Williams and another man were standing at the Lexington Avenue-63rd Street station when Hernandez allegedly pushed them onto the tracks. Fortunately, the other man, John Pena, managed to rescue Williams from certain death moments before a train arrived.

Despite his heroic efforts, Williams succumbed to his injuries on March 17, leaving behind a grieving family. His daughter, Debbie Williams, expressed her frustration with the legal system, stating, "I want him to suffer for the rest of his life."

This case is not an isolated incident. Hernandez, a known criminal with a lengthy rap sheet, had been deported from the United States four times but continued to re-enter the country illegally.
